The Statue of GWK

When it’s finished, the statue of GWK will be one of the tallest statue in the world. Right now Nyoman Nuarta, the sculptor, has finished three parts of the statue. The body of Wisnu on Wisnu Plaza. The head of Garuda on Garuda Plaza. The hands of Wisnu on Tirta Agung.

Rindik Music

Rindik is a Balinese musical instrument which can produce mesmerizingly beautiful sound. Rindik is an instrument best played in a group, so by playing it you can learn to create melody and harmony through a good teamwork with other musical instruments.

Kecak Dance

Located at GWK Amphitheater, everyday at 18:00 WITA, you should not miss our special Kecak Dance performance. This one-hour show combine the dynamic fire dance, the enchanting chants, and the serenity of traditional Balinese culture.
